Описывается список с полями согласно type student = record fam: string; inn: string; year: integer; god_p: integer; kurs: 1..5; gruppa: string; b1, b2, b3: 1..5; end; объявляются необходимые переменные и массив с типом записи var spisok: array [1..n] of student; b, a: string; i, j, k1: integer; и заполняется от 1 до n (n=5 установлена константа)for i : = 1 to n do // идем от 1 до n и заполняем список with spisok[i] do begin writeln('введите фамилию'); readln(fam); {}end; потом обрабатывается согласно по вариантамскорее всего, что-то типо сортировки по году рождения, самых молодых пихают в начало.(глупо. можно было не городить такой кусок кода, а уместить все в один цикл с проверкой и выводом имхо)затем выводится 3 фамилии самых молодых for i : = 1 to 3 do begin write(spisok[i].fam); writeln; end;
Suralevartem
05.04.2023
1: ну-с, три раза циклом идем начиная с 1 до 3 и получается следующее: идем первый раз: s: =1+1*1 в результате s = 2; идем второй раз: s: =2+2*2 в результате s = 6; идем третий раз: s: =6+3*3 в результате s = 15; ответ: s = 15; 2: в результате выполнения программы будет выведены 6 чисел которые получились в результате вычисления s: =s+2*j; т.е. как и в предыдущем (1) идем циклом с 10 до 15 и считаем, а после сразу выводим. s: = 0 + 2*10; s=20; s: = 20 + 2*11; s=42; s: = 42 + 2*12; s=66; s: = 66+2*13; s=92; s: =92+2*14; s= 120; s: =120 + 2*15; s=150; 3: крч все тоже самое цикл и т.д.ответ: 5 20 60 120 120
Ответить на вопрос
Поделитесь своими знаниями, ответьте на вопрос:
Перевести 2048 байт в кбит 3 кбит в байт 1536 байт в кбит